Man City's Richards blasts greedy claims

Micah Richards has blasted talk that he is being greedy over a new contract.

The 19-year-old Manchester City defender is set to sign a £50,000-per-week deal when contract talks resume next month.

But the fact that a deal had not already been signed led to suggestions that Newcastle were ready to step in for the Blues Academy graduate.

Richards is believed to have swapped agents recently, which may have been a factor in any delay.

He said: "It is frustrating to hear people talk about my new contract at City and make out that the reason I haven't signed yet is because I am being greedy when they don't know the facts.

"I have still got two-and-a-half years left on my current deal - it is not as though I am in my last year or six months - and things don't happen overnight.

"As for the speculation linking me with a move to join Kevin Keegan at Newcastle, I don't know where that has come from, but there is nothing in it.

"It is easy for people to make out I am something I am not. But football, and doing well on the pitch, is the most important thing to me"
